Our REDCap servers are backed up at intervals throughout the day, based on current University of Alberta policy. The backups are stored "off-site" in the backup data centre. In the unlikely event of a total failure of the main data centre, service will be restored using the backup data centre.
While backups allow the entire REDCap system to be restored from a known point in time, they do not allow for the restoration of individual projects. If required, authorized members of a study team can use existing REDCap features to create backups of study data and metadata. For example, prior to making significant changes to study design. These features include one or more of the following:
Exporting study data
Downloading the data dictionary
Download an XML backup (See the project's Other Functionality tab).
Instructions on creating backups of these project components can be found on our Backup a REDCap Project page.
